An iterative form-finding method for antifunicular shapes in spatial arch bridges
چکیده انگلیسی

This paper presents a new iterative method for finding antifunicular out-of-plane shapes for spatial arch bridges. For a given set of loads, this is the warped geometry that results in an equilibrium state free from bending stresses, i.e. simply under axial forces. These shapes appear when out-of-plane loads act upon the arch, for example, when the deck is curved in plan. A detailed formulation with two alternative algorithms is presented that solves the most generalised case, where unsymmetrical bridges with clamped ends and non-linear behaviour can be considered. An uncoupled formulation has also been developed, in order to minimise internal forces, in both vertical and leaning plane arches. The method can be used both for upper and lower deck arch bridges. It can also be easily adapted for tension elements or cables.
